The aim of the course:
With this course, students will be applied to the sector by using his professional knowledge to be able to create all the details of a project.
 
Learning OutcomesCTPOTOA
Upon successful completion of the course, the students will be able to :
LO - 1 : Determine the scope and purpose of system / product .1,2,3,6,7,8,9,104,6
LO - 2 : Make detailed research on the subject of the system / product.1,2,3,6,7,8,9,104,6
LO - 3 : Make the computation / software for the system / product.1,2,3,6,7,8,9,104,6
LO - 4 : Perform the system / product.1,2,3,6,7,8,9,104,6
LO - 5 : Deliver the outputs of the system / product.1,2,3,6,7,8,9,104,6
CTPO : Contribution to programme outcomes, TOA :Type of assessment (1: written exam, 2: Oral exam, 3: Homework assignment, 4: Laboratory exercise/exam, 5: Seminar / presentation, 6: Term paper), LO : Learning Outcome

 
Contents of the Course
1. Interest in the subject field to select the specified project. 2. Algorithm and Flow Chart to Identify the project. 3. Get Detailed Proposals for the project, Writing and Testing Code. 4. Presentation of the project to do. 5. Prepare the report booklet containing all Stages of the project.
